Commercial Information Circular No. 284/2012
European Union (EU)* : Imposition of a Definitive Anti-dumping Duty on Imports of Oxalic Acid Originating in, inter alia, the Mainland of China
Further to the Commercial Information Circular No. 651/2011 of 20 October 2011, the Council of the EU has published a regulation to impose a definitive anti-dumping duty on imports of oxalic acid originating in, inter alia, the Mainland of China. DETAILS
2.Salient points are set out below -
(a) Product | : | Oxalic acid, whether in dihydrate (CUS number 0028635-1 and CAS number 6153-56-6) or anhydrous form (CUS number 0021238-4 and CAS number 144-62-7) and whether or not in aqueous solution, currently falling within CN code ex 2917 11 00 (TARIC code 2917 11 00 91). |
(b) Rate of Duty | : | 52.2% of the net, free-at-Union-frontier price before duty (except for three companies whose individual duty rates range from 14.6% to 37.7%). |
(c) Effective Date | : | 19 April 2012 |
(d) Duration | : | 5 years |
(e) Collection of Duty | : | The amounts secured by way of the provisional anti-dumping duty pursuant to Commission Regulation (EU) No 1043/2011 shall be definitively collected. The amounts secured in excess of the amount of the definitive anti-dumping duties shall be released. |
